> `R_InputHandlers` isn't actually a function, it's a linked list of structures 
> holding input handlers.  rgl links into it to handle mouse and keyboard 
> interaction when it is displaying a window in X11.

Ideally the code generating the NOTE should be revised since a few of
the things checked for at that point are global variables, not entry
points.

Given the design of this interface this variable should be added to
the embedding API and dropped from the check list. I have not dropped
it from the check list in R-devel so you should no longer get this
NOTE.
